An ultra-long-haul flight is a nonstop air service exceeding approximately 12 hours of flight time or 10,000 kilometers in distance, requiring specialized aircraft, crew management protocols, and cabin configurations designed to sustain passenger well-being over extreme durations.
What Is an Ultra-Long-Haul Flight?
Ultra-long-haul is the frontier of commercial aviation range. These flights push against the physiological limits of passengers and crew, the regulatory boundaries of flight duty time, and the technological limits of aircraft fuel capacity and range. Routes in this category include Singapore to New York, London to Perth, Sydney to Dallas-Fort Worth, and the ultimate benchmark of commercial aviation range: Singapore Airlines Flight SQ21 and SQ22 between Singapore Changi Airport and New York Newark, covering approximately 15,343 kilometers in around 18 to 19 hours — currently the world's longest commercial flight.
How It Works in Practice
Ultra-long-haul operations require aircraft with exceptional range and fuel efficiency. Singapore Airlines uses the Airbus A350-900ULR (Ultra Long Range) for the SQ21/SQ22 Changi to Newark route, an aircraft designed with additional fuel capacity and structural modifications for the purpose. The cabin on these flights is typically configured with only premium classes — business and premium economy — to reduce passenger density and maximize revenue per seat. Crew are rostered in multiple teams (typically three sets of pilots) rotating through mandatory rest periods in dedicated crew rest areas. Qantas's Project Sunrise aims to launch nonstop flights from Sydney to London and Sydney to New York using Airbus A350s, with durations of approximately 20 hours.
Why It Matters
Ultra-long-haul flights matter commercially because they eliminate connection stops on the world's highest-demand intercontinental city pairs, saving travelers 2 to 5 hours compared to hub-routed alternatives. Passengers on premium cabins value nonstop time savings highly, enabling premium pricing that justifies the high operational cost. Technologically, ultra-long-haul routes drive aircraft manufacturers to improve range and fuel efficiency, benefiting the entire industry.
Key Facts and Figures
- SQ21/SQ22 (Singapore-New York Newark, ~15,343 km) is the world's current longest commercial flight
- The A350-900ULR carries extra fuel, approximately 158,000 liters, and has a maximum range of 18,000 km
- Qantas Project Sunrise targets nonstop Sydney-London (~17,000 km) with A350 aircraft, expected by 2027
- Cabin pressure management and humidity controls are enhanced on ultra-long-haul aircraft to reduce passenger fatigue
